What Is Vail’s Off-Season?

Vail’s off-season typically happens:

  • Late April through early June (after ski season winds down)
  • Mid-October through late November (after fall colors fade and before ski season begins)

These transitional periods are often overlooked but from a guest’s perspective, they offer some of the most relaxing and rewarding stays of the year.

The Beauty of the Transitional Seasons

There’s something uniquely beautiful about the in-between seasons.

Spring in Vail

  • Snow melting into flowing creeks
  • Sunny afternoons with cool evenings
  • Early hiking and biking conditions
  • Wildlife becoming active

Fall in Vail

  • Crisp alpine air
  • Golden aspens surrounding the valley
  • Peaceful forest trails
  • Cozy evenings inside
